Kai Ko recently revealed that he actually gained nearly 10kgs for his role in the new movie, “I Blew Out the Candles Before Making a Wish”.

The actor, who plays the role of a soft-hearted debt collector in the movie, said that he deliberately gained the weight to portray the life of a Macau casino employee.

“Macau casino employees work day and night shifts, and due to the fact that they eat late-night snacks, the director wanted the character to not be too thin. I needed to gain weight in a short period of time, which put a strain on my body. I was worried that my metabolism would slow down after I turned 30, making it difficult to lose weight later,” he said.

Besides the physical challenge, Kai revealed that he also spent six months learning Cantonese from a teacher. He joked that he was most afraid of being teased by his young co-star Mui Cheng-in, who plays the lead character Jojo in the movie.

“The tones of Cantonese are really difficult. If you mispronounce it, it can become a completely different meaning, or even a derogatory word. Fortunately, Cheng-in would correct me gently, which helped me gradually master it.”

In the movie, Kai plays a debt collector who collaborates with an 11-year-old who orchestrates a casino scheme in the hopes of solving her family’s problems.
